The Belgrade-Brooten-Elrosa Clay Trapshooting team had 25 members compete at the Class 5A state trap meet last Friday, June 16 in Alexandria. High Gun - Varsity Male Gabe Coners finished in an 11-way tie for 26th place out of 334 with a 94. Xavier Coners, James Wesbur and Owen Radermacher finished in a 22-way tie for 72nd place with a 91. Tate DeKok was also in the Top 100 with a 90, good for an 11-way tie for 94th place. Toby Hanson: 89. Mason Eckstein: 89. Dominic Finken: 85. Kaden Pieper:...

After winning three of their five Section 6A games by just one run, the Belgrade-Brooten-Elrosa baseball team continued their improbable playoff run with yet another one-run win. This time that win came on the biggest stage they've played on yet: Class 1A state playoffs at Joe Faber Field in St. Cloud. After coming back from a 1-0 deficit with two runs scored in the top of the fourth, the Jaguars shocked No. 1-seeded and state tournament veteran South Ridge in a 2-1 regulation-innings win on...

After three straight captivating performances in the Section 6A winner's bracket, the Belgrade-Brooten-Elrosa baseball team landed a spot in the state-qualifying championship series earlier this week. Facing a red hot Parkers Prairie team that had blazed its way through the elimination bracket of the tournament, the Jaguars broke a 1-1 tie with three runs scored in the bottom of the sixth inning. The first of those three runs was on a wild pitch that brought Hayden Sobiech home, while the...

After a remarkable performance in the Section 5A finals on Wednesday, May 31, the Belgrade-Brooten-Elrosa boys' golf team has punched its ticket to the state golf meet for the second year in a row and second time overall in school history. With senior Brady Schwinghammer carding a 71 in his final 18 holes, the Jaguars shot a 703 overall across the two-day section meet to defeated runner-up Dawson-Boyd, who shot a 707. Schwinghammer finished with a score of 149 to win the Section 5A individual...

Sunburg's 18th annual Syttende Mai celebration was held on what was perhaps the most perfect day they could have asked for on Sunday, May 21. The weather featured temperatures in the upper 70s, full sunshine and a light breeze. That, combined with a huge turnout of people for the full day of activities, made for a day that the Sunburg community should be proud of.
